The Role of Intent Data in Sales Intelligence

Understanding Intent Data

Intent data represents the digital breadcrumbs prospects leave behind as they research solutions online. You can think of it as a window into your potential customers' buying journey—capturing their searches, content consumption, website visits, and engagement patterns across the web. This information reveals which companies are actively evaluating solutions like yours, even before they reach out to vendors.

How Intent Data is Collected

The collection process happens through multiple channels:

  1. First-party intent data: This comes directly from your own digital properties—tracking how prospects interact with your website, download resources, or engage with your content.
  2. Third-party intent data: This aggregates behavioral signals from publisher networks, review sites, and B2B platforms where prospects consume industry-specific content.

When someone from a target company repeatedly reads articles about payment processing solutions or downloads whitepapers on fraud prevention, that's a buyer signal worth acting on.

The Advantage of Identifying Active Researchers

You gain a significant advantage when you can identify these active researchers. Traditional sales approaches often involve cold outreach to companies that may not be in-market. Intent data flips this model by showing you exactly which organizations are demonstrating buying behavior right now.

For example, a financial services company researching "embedded banking APIs" or "real-time payment infrastructure" is signaling clear interest—giving your sales team the perfect opening for timely prospect engagement.

The Importance of Timing and Relevance

The real power lies in timing and relevance. When you spot these intent signals, you can reach out with messages that directly address what prospects are researching.

If a company's employees are consuming content about regulatory compliance solutions, your outreach can focus specifically on how your platform addresses compliance challenges. This targeted approach transforms cold outreach into warm conversations because you're engaging prospects when they're actively seeking solutions, not interrupting them with generic pitches.

Enhancing Lead Prioritization with Technographic and Behavioral Filters

Technographic filters transform how you identify prospects by revealing the exact technology stack your potential customers use. When you know a company runs on outdated payment processing systems or legacy banking software, you can tailor your pitch to address their specific pain points. This data-driven approach helps you focus on accounts that genuinely need your solution rather than casting a wide net and hoping for the best.

You can segment prospects based on:

  • Current technology infrastructure and software usage
  • Recent technology adoptions or migrations
  • Technology spending patterns and budget allocations
  • Integration capabilities with your FinTech solution

Buyer behavior analysis adds another dimension to your lead prioritization strategy. You track digital footprints—website visits, content downloads, webinar attendance, and social media engagement—to gauge genuine interest levels. When a prospect downloads three whitepapers about blockchain payment solutions in one week, that's a clear signal they're actively evaluating options.

The combination of technographic and behavioral data creates a powerful scoring system. You assign higher priority to leads showing both technical fit and active buying signals. A company using compatible technology and researching solutions in your category becomes your ideal target.

This precision targeting delivers measurable results. Conversion rates increase up to four times when you focus on high-fit, in-market prospects rather than cold outreach to unqualified leads. Your sales team spends less time chasing dead ends and more time engaging with prospects ready to have meaningful conversations. The efficiency gains compound—shorter sales cycles, higher win rates, and better resource allocation across your sales organization.

Overcoming Challenges in FinTech Sales Intelligence Adoption

Adopting sales intelligence tools in the FinTech sector comes with distinct hurdles that you need to address head-on. The regulatory landscape and technical complexities can make or break your implementation strategy.

Navigating Data Privacy Regulations in FinTech

Data privacy regulations fintech companies face are among the strictest in any industry. You're dealing with GDPR in Europe, CCPA in California, and sector-specific requirements like PCI-DSS for payment processing. When you implement intent data solutions, you must ensure every data point collected, stored, and processed meets these compliance standards.

Your sales intelligence platform needs built-in consent management features. You can't afford to engage prospects using data obtained without proper authorization. The penalties are severe—GDPR violations can cost up to 4% of annual global turnover. I've seen FinTech companies delay their sales intelligence rollouts by months just to get their compliance frameworks right.

You should work closely with your legal and compliance teams from day one. They'll help you understand which data sources are permissible, how long you can retain prospect information, and what disclosure requirements apply to your outreach activities.

Addressing Integration Complexities

Integration complexities fintech sales tools present another significant barrier. Your existing tech stack likely includes specialized FinTech CRMs, risk assessment platforms, and customer onboarding systems. Adding sales intelligence tools means connecting multiple APIs, syncing data fields, and ensuring real-time updates flow seamlessly.

You'll encounter data mapping challenges where field names don't align between systems. Custom objects in your CRM may not have direct equivalents in your new sales intelligence platform. Budget extra time for testing—what works in a sandbox environment often behaves differently in production.

Training your sales team on new workflows is equally critical. You need champions who understand both the technical setup and practical applications of intent data in daily prospecting activities.
